Lumina Solar Project
Intersect Power · Scurry County · ERCOT
Lumina Solar Project is a co-located solar-and-storage plant in Scurry County, Texas. EIA's May 2026 inventory reports a 326.6 MW nameplate solar generator with 320 MW seasonal capability, dated January 2024, and a separate 160 MW battery generator dated September 2025. Intersect Power's 828 MWp / 640 MWac Lumina announcement covers the broader two-plant Lumina solar development, while its $837 million battery financing covers three Texas storage projects; neither broader figure is assigned solely to EIA Plant 65645.
